This is the twenty-first in the Bond series and the first film to star Daniel Craig as James Bond and my first Bond film seen in a theatre.

Basically it is a reboot and here we get to see an MI6 operative promoted to 00 agent status by assassinating two targets.

So to achieve a licence to kill, he has to kill minimum two targets.

In this one Bond pursues a bomb-maker which leads him to a corrupt official Alex Dimitrios in the Bahamas.

Bond later uncovers the plot of the destruction of Skyfleet's prototype airliner by a private banker to terrorists known as Le Chiffre.

This film has one of the best parkour chase sequence.

It has old skool action n thankfully there is no reliance on gadgets n cgi.

One of the best part is that we get to see a Bond who is inexperienced, vulnerable n his transition to a cold blooded killer is very well done. Thank God, ther is no cheeky humor.

Daniel Craig in this movie is in very good shape n at times his character is believable, which can run, sprint, endure both torture n poison and sometimes who gives a damn whether its shaken or stirred, unlike his predecessors.

This time Bond faces Le Chiffre n his henchmen Valenka, Alex Dimitrios, Kratt, Carlos Nikolic and one of the world's best free runner Mollaka Danso, a freelance terrorist working for Chiffre n Dimitrios.

Bond also faces the machete yielding terrorist Steven Obanno n his bodyguard.

Bond pursues Mr. White n faces his henchmen, the most famous being Adolph Gettler, the man with a unique glasses who gets shot in the eye.
